Insecticidal activity of Jatropha curcas extracts against housefly, Musca domestica
2015
Chauhan, Nitin | Kumar, Peeyush | Mishra, Sapna | Verma, Sharad | Malik, Anushree | Sharma, Satyawati
The hexane and ether extracts of leaves, bark and roots of Jatropha curcas were screened for their toxicity against different developmental stages of housefly. The larvicidal, pupicidal and adulticidal activities were analysed at various concentrations (0.78–7.86 mg/cm²) of hexane and ether extracts. The lethal concentration values (LC₅₀) of hexane extract of J. curcas leaves were 3.0 and 0.27 mg/cm² for adult and larval stages of housefly, respectively, after 48 h. Similarly, the ether extract of leaf showed the LC₅₀ of 2.20 and 4.53 mg/cm² for adult and larval stages of housefly. Least toxicity was observed with hexane root extract of J. curcas with LC₅₀ values of 14.18 and 14.26 mg/cm² for adult and larvae of housefly, respectively, after 48 h. The variation in LC₅₀ against housefly pupae was found to be 8.88–13.10 mg/cm² at various J. curcas extract concentrations. The GC-MS analysis of J. curcas leaf extract revealed the presence of trans-phytol (60.81 %), squalene (28.58 %), phytol (2.52 %) and nonadecanone (1.06 %) as major components that could be attributed for insecticidal activity of J. curcas extracts.
